Grant Will Aid Improvements at Brownville Concert Hall
01/17/2017

(KLZA)-- Major improvements will be made to the Brownville Concert Hall thanks to a $350,000 Community Development Block Grant Award from the Department of Economic Development.  

The funds are designed to help Nebraska communities improve tourist attractions, to enable severely disabled persons and the elderly accessibility to the attraction’s buildings and grounds.

The sponsor beneficiary is the Brownville Concert Series. The concert series is a program of the Brownville Fine Arts Association. $109,000 in matching funds are required. 

The renovation of the Brownville Concert Hall is to bring the facility into compliance with the Americans with Disability Act regulations and structural improvements.  

Major improvements are to include roof replacement and foundation stabilization along with accessible restrooms, lobby, concessions, entrances and an elevator.
